Visit cdc. Healthy relationships in adolescence can help shape a young person’s identity 1 and prepare teens for more positive relationships during adulthood. Frequency of adolescent dating . Young people tend to become more interested in dating around their mid-teens and become more involved in dating relationships during high school. Although dating does increase during this time, it is also normal for adolescents not to be in a relationship.

Despite the success of dating apps such as Bumble – on which women are required to initiate conversation – traditional gender roles still dominate the world of online dating , according to new research. A major new study carried out by the Oxford Internet Institute OII and eHarmony found that men are 30 per cent more likely than women to initiate conversation, and when a woman does send the first message, the response rate drops by 15 per cent.

The researchers, from Oxford University, analysed , profiles and over 10 years of eHarmony data, tracking changing preferences and communication patterns among single Brits. The past decade has seen the rise of dating apps and the breakdown of any stigma surrounding looking for love online. But despite this – and progress being made towards gender equality – the researchers found that the number of men initiating conversations online has actually increased, from six per cent in to 30 per cent in The researchers also looked into what would make someone more likely to receive a message.

They found men were more successful when they had more photos on their profiles, as well as if they were perceived to be athletic, agreeable and altruistic. Similarly, women who appear athletic, romantic and altruistic are more likely to be messaged on dating apps.
